Core Refusal Reason
The proposal constitutes overdevelopment of a limited landholding through speculative site sales and is located on a substandard agricultural laneway with inadequate sightlines.
Decision Maker's Conclusion
- The development would result in a third dwelling on a relatively limited landholding over a six-year period where sites have been sold speculatively rather than retained for family occupancy, leading to overdevelopment and the encroachment of random rural development.
- The proposed site is accessed via a substandard agricultural laneway that is insufficient in width and surface quality to accommodate residential development.
- The applicant failed to demonstrate sufficient control over adjacent lands to provide the necessary unobstructed sightlines, posing a risk to public safety by reason of traffic hazard.

Decision Document Summary
Laura Morgan sought planning permission for a single-storey dwelling, garage, and wastewater treatment system at Kilmainham, Kells, Co. Meath. The site is located in a rural area designated as a 'Stronger Rural Area' under the Meath County Development Plan 2021-2027. While the applicant met the local housing need criteria, the application was refused because the landholding had already seen multiple speculative site sales, leading to overdevelopment.
